What did Schlafly suggest would happen if the ERA were ratified? (1 p

A. Women would lose access to abortion.
B. Women would lose the right to vote.
C. Women would lose financial support for themselves and their children.
D. Women would be barred from the military.

1 answer

C. Women would lose financial support for themselves and their children.

Phyllis Schlafly argued that the ratification of the Equal Rights Amendment (ERA) would lead to the elimination of various legal protections for women, including alimony and child support, which would negatively impact their financial security.
